Stopped off for a coffee at the a64 McDonalds this morning. Just parked up to sort out my drink holder etc. when 2 north yorkshire traffic cars pulled in and parked up next to each other. 2 Minutes after that a luton/box type van drove past me and was circling the carpark.. I watched as he turned a corner and thought "he's gonna clip that nissan" *crunch*

He slowed down for 2 seconds, before promptly buggering off to hide in the Triton's fish & chip shop carpark on the other side of a 5ft wooden fence. I tried to get his reg but couldn't get a good view of it and he wasn't exactly hanging around..

I'm not having that mate - I let the two traffic officers know, one of them tootled off to collar the driver of the van while the other came and looked at the damage with me & got my details. Big dint about the size of a galia melon on the rear nearside wing and a big gash in the paintwork.. Relatively new car as well.
